Chicken Fajita Casserole Recipe

Prep: 15 minutes
Cook: 25 minutes
Yields: 4 servings

First, preheat your oven to 350°F with the rack 6 to 8 inches from the heat source. While that’s warming up, coat a 7- x 11-inch baking dish with cooking spray and set it aside.

Next, heat some oil in a large skillet over medium-high. Add sliced bell peppers, poblano, and onion, and cook until they’re softened and starting to char in spots. This should take about 5 minutes, but trust me, it’s worth the wait.

Now it’s time to add some flavor to the mix. Add diced green chiles with juices, fajita seasoning, garlic, and a pinch of salt. Cook for about a minute, stirring constantly, until everything is fragrant and amazing.

Remove the skillet from the heat and stir in some shredded cooked chicken breasts. Set it aside for now, but don’t worry, it’ll be back in the spotlight soon.

In a large bowl, combine cream cheese, shredded white Cheddar, and smoked Cheddar. Yes, you read that right – two types of cheese Mix everything together until it’s smooth and creamy.

Add the chicken mixture to the bowl and stir until everything is combined. Transfer the mixture to the prepared baking dish and sprinkle some extra cheese on top because, why not?

Pop the dish into the oven and bake until the mixture is bubbling and the cheese is melted and golden brown. This should take about 25 minutes, but keep an eye on it to make sure it doesn’t get too brown.

Once it’s done, remove it from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es. Sprinkle some chopped cilantro on top and serve it with your favorite toppings, like sour cream, avocado, and salsa.

Printable Recipe

Ingredients

  1. 1 tablespoon oil
  2. 1 cup sliced bell peppers
  3. 1 cup sliced poblano
  4. 1 cup sliced onion
  5. 1 can diced green chiles with juices
  6. 1 tablespoon fajita seasoning
  7. 2 cloves garlic, minced
  8. 1/2 teaspoon salt
  9. 2 cups shredded cooked chicken
  10. 8 ounces cream cheese
  11. 1 cup shredded white Cheddar
  12. 1 cup shredded smoked Cheddar
  13. 1/2 cup extra cheese for topping
  14. Chopped cilantro for garnish
  15. Sour cream, avocado, and salsa for serving

Instructions

  1. 1. Preheat your oven to 350°F with the rack 6 to 8 inches from the heat source.
  2. 2. Coat a 7- x 11-inch baking dish with cooking spray and set it aside.
  3. 3.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
  4. 4. Add sliced bell peppers, poblano, and onion, and cook until softened and starting to char, about 5 minutes.
  5. 5. Add diced green chiles with juices, fajita seasoning, garlic, and a pinch of salt. Cook for about a minute, stirring until fragrant.
  6. 6. Remove the skillet from heat and stir in shredded cooked chicken breasts. Set aside.
  7. 7. In a large bowl, combine cream cheese, shredded white Cheddar, and smoked Cheddar and mix until smooth and creamy.
  8. 8. Add the chicken mixture to the bowl and stir until combined.
  9. 9. Transfer the mixture to the prepared baking dish and sprinkle extra cheese on top.
  10. 10. Bake the dish until bubbling and the cheese is melted and golden brown, about 25 minutes.
  11. 11. Remove from the oven and let cool for a few minutes. Sprinkle with chopped cilantro and serve with your favorite toppings.
